Cost of Drain Field Excavation in Brighton
Drain field excavation is a crucial process for maintaining a functional septic system in Brighton, CO. Understanding the costs involved can help homeowners budget effectively and ensure their septic systems remain in good working order.
Factors Affecting Cost
- Soil Type: Different soil types require varying levels of effort and equipment, impacting the overall cost.
- Size of the Drain Field: Larger drain fields will naturally cost more due to the increased amount of work and materials needed.
- Depth of Excavation: Deeper excavations are more labor-intensive and require specialized equipment, which can increase costs.
- Permits and Inspections: Local regulations may require permits and inspections, adding to the overall expense.
- Accessibility: If the site is difficult to access, additional equipment or labor may be needed, increasing the cost.
- Labor Rates: Labor costs can vary based on the expertise and rates of local contractors in Brighton, CO.
- Material Costs: The price of materials such as gravel, pipes, and liners can fluctuate, affecting the total cost.
- Weather Conditions: Adverse weather can delay projects and add to labor costs.
Average Costs for Common Tasks
Task | Average Cost (Brighton, CO) |
---|---|
Soil Testing | $300 - $500 |
Permitting | $200 - $400 |
Excavation (per square foot) | $10 - $15 |
Installation of Drain Pipes | $1,500 - $3,000 |
Gravel and Other Materials | $500 - $1,000 |
Inspection Fees | $100 - $300 |
Total Average Cost | $4,000 - $7,000 |
